在探讨现代数字生活的交织网络时,一些看似毫无关联的名词往往在幕后扮演着相辅相成的角色,亚马逊DNS、Xbox,这三个词分别代表了云计算、网络协议和家庭娱乐的巨头,它们之间的联系并非一目了然,却深刻地影响着全球数百万游戏玩家的在线体验,要理解这种联系,我们需要首先拆解每一个核心概念,然后将它们重新组合,描绘出一幅完整的数字服务蓝图。

解构核心:DNS、亚马逊与Xbox
什么是DNS?
DNS,全称为域名系统,是互联网的“电话簿”,当我们在浏览器中输入一个网址,如 www.xbox.com,或在Xbox上连接在线服务时,我们的设备并不直接理解这个人类可读的名称,DNS的作用就是将这个域名翻译成机器能够识别的一串数字,即IP地址(0.2.1),没有DNS,我们将需要记住无数复杂的IP地址才能访问网络上的任何服务,互联网的便捷性将荡然无存,这个过程被称为“DNS解析”,是所有网络活动的第一步。
亚马逊DNS (AWS Route 53) 的角色
当人们提到“亚马逊DNS”时,通常指的是亚马逊云服务(AWS)旗下的一个高可用性和可扩展性的云域名网络服务——Route 53,这里必须澄清一个关键概念:Route 53主要是一个权威DNS服务器,而不是我们通常在家庭网络中设置的递归DNS服务器(如谷歌的8.8.8.8或Cloudflare的1.1.1.1)。
- 权威DNS服务器:它好比是某个特定域名的“官方信息源”,它存储并负责提供该域名及其子域名的真实IP地址记录,当一个递归DNS服务器想知道
xboxlive.com的IP地址时,它会去查询xboxlive.com的权威DNS服务器。 - 递归DNS服务器:它好比是“图书管理员”,当你的设备发出查询请求时,它会代替你进行一系列的查询,最终找到权威DNS服务器并获取IP地址,然后将结果返回给你的设备,普通用户在家用路由器或游戏机上设置的DNS地址,就是递归DNS服务器的地址。
AWS Route 53之所以强大,在于它不仅仅是一个简单的“电话簿”,它提供了高级流量管理功能,
- 延迟路由:可以将用户导向全球范围内延迟最低的服务器。
- 地理位置路由:根据用户的地理位置将其导向最近的服务器。
- 加权路由:可以将不同比例的流量分配到不同的服务器,用于A/B测试或灰度发布。
- 健康检查:可以监控服务器的健康状况,自动将流量从发生故障的服务器转移到健康的实例上。
Xbox 与网络连接
对于Xbox游戏机而言,DNS是其在线生命线,无论是登录Xbox Live、下载游戏更新、观看流媒体内容,还是进行激烈的在线多人对战,每一次连接都始于一次DNS查询,默认情况下,Xbox会使用网络服务提供商(ISP)自动分配的DNS服务器,对于大多数用户而言,这已经足够使用,一些追求极致性能或特定功能的玩家会选择手动更改DNS设置。
幕后英雄:它们如何协同工作?
我们将这三者联系起来,普通Xbox玩家几乎永远不会直接与AWS Route 53交互(即,不会将Route 53的地址填入Xbox的网络设置),它们之间的联系是间接但至关重要的,发生在服务提供商层面。

游戏巨头的选择
微软(Xbox的母公司)以及全球各大游戏开发商和发行商(如EA、Ubisoft、Epic Games)在构建其庞大的在线服务基础设施时,需要确保其服务的可靠性、可扩展性和低延迟,AWS Route 53正是实现这一目标的理想工具。
当你在Xbox上启动一款在线游戏时,堡垒之夜》,你的游戏机需要连接到Epic Games的服务器,这个过程大致如下:
- 你的Xbox向配置的递归DNS服务器(可能是ISP的,也可能是你手动设置的如8.8.8.8)发送查询请求,询问
play.fortnite.com的IP地址。 - 递归DNS服务器经过一系列查询,最终找到负责
play.fortnite.com的权威DNS服务器——这个服务器很可能就是由AWS Route 53托管的。 - Route 53接收到查询请求后,会根据其预设的规则(延迟路由)进行判断,它会检测到你所在的地理位置,并计算出哪个游戏服务器集群对你的网络延迟最低。
- Route 53返回那个最佳服务器的IP地址给你的递归DNS服务器。
- 递归DNS服务器再将这个IP地址返回给你的Xbox。
- 你的Xbox与这个经过智能筛选的、延迟最低的服务器建立连接,开始游戏。
通过这个流程可以看出,AWS Route 53扮演了“智能交通调度员”的角色,它确保了全球数百万玩家能够被动态、高效地分配到最合适的游戏服务器,从而获得流畅、稳定的在线体验,没有这种高级DNS路由,玩家可能会连接到遥远或过载的服务器,导致高延迟(Ping值)、卡顿甚至掉线。
下表清晰地展示了这种分工:
| 角色 | 功能 | 示例 |
|---|---|---|
| Xbox | 客户端设备,发起网络请求 | 游戏机 |
| 递归DNS | 代替用户查询,获取IP地址 | ISP DNS, Google 8.8.8.8, Cloudflare 1.1.1.1 |
| 权威DNS (Route 53) | 域名的官方信息源,智能分配IP | 托管 xboxlive.com, ea.com 等域名 |
普通用户视角:是否需要为Xbox更换DNS?
既然Route 53在幕后如此重要,那么作为用户,我们是否应该将Xbox的DNS设置得更“高级”一些呢?答案是:视情况而定,但不要期望它能解决所有网络问题。
更换递归DNS服务器(从ISP的更换为Cloudflare的1.1.1.1)可能带来的好处包括:
- 更快的解析速度:一些公共DNS服务可能比ISP的响应更快,但这通常只会带来毫秒级的提升,对于整体游戏延迟(通常几十到几百毫秒)影响微乎其微。
- 增强的隐私和安全:部分公共DNS服务提供更严格的隐私保护,防止DNS查询被追踪或劫持。
- 内容过滤和家长控制:像OpenDNS FamilyShield这样的服务可以自动拦截成人内容和不适宜的网站。
- 广告拦截:一些DNS服务(如NextDNS)可以拦截已知的广告和跟踪器域名,在系统层面减少广告。
必须强调,更换DNS无法降低游戏本身的服务器延迟(Ping值),Ping值主要取决于你的物理位置与游戏服务器之间的距离、网络线路质量以及你的本地网络环境,DNS查询只是连接前的第一步,其耗时在整个游戏过程中几乎可以忽略不计,如果游戏卡顿,问题更可能出在带宽、丢包或服务器本身,而非DNS。

高级用户的实践
对于极少数技术爱好者,他们可能会利用AWS Route 53来管理自己的个人域名,并从Xbox上访问自建的媒体服务器(如Plex)或其他网络服务,在这种情况下,Route 53确实直接为Xbox提供了其个人域名的权威解析,但这属于非常小众的应用场景。
相关问答FAQs
问题1:我可以将我的Xbox DNS服务器地址设置为亚马逊Route 53的地址来改善游戏性能吗?
解答: 不可以,这是一个常见的误解,AWS Route 53是一个权威DNS服务,它的职责是回答“我的域名(mygame.com)对应的IP是什么?”这类问题,它不负责为普通用户提供递归查询服务,你不能像使用Google DNS (8.8.8.8) 或Cloudflare DNS (1.1.1.1) 那样,将Route 53的地址填入Xbox的网络设置中,这样做不仅无法工作,还会导致你的Xbox无法解析任何域名,游戏性能的优化,尤其是延迟的降低,依赖于游戏服务商(如微软)在幕后使用Route 53这类服务进行智能流量调度,而不是终端用户的设置。
问题2:除了游戏,在Xbox上自定义DNS设置还有哪些实际用途?
解答: 在Xbox上自定义DNS设置的主要用途集中在网络控制和安全层面,而非直接提升游戏性能,具体包括:
- 家长控制与内容过滤:使用如OpenDNS FamilyShield等专门提供内容过滤的DNS服务,可以自动阻止访问成人网站、暴力内容或其他不适宜的网页,为家庭创造一个更安全的上网环境。
- 隐私保护:一些注重隐私的DNS服务商(如Cloudflare、Quad9)承诺不记录用户的查询历史,可以防止你的网络浏览习惯被追踪或出售。
- 广告与跟踪器拦截:通过配置支持广告拦截功能的DNS服务(如NextDNS或AdGuard DNS),可以在整个系统层面(包括Xbox的Edge浏览器和一些应用)屏蔽部分广告和网络跟踪器,提升浏览体验和加载速度。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/264649.html